'Ghost Adventures' star files for divorce after wife arrested in murder-for-hire plot

Aaron Goodwin has filed for divorce a week after the "Ghost Adventures" star's wife was arrested in Las Vegas on suspicion of a murder plot, with the TV personality as the intended target.

Clark County court records reviewed by USA TODAY show Aaron Goodwin, 48, filed a complaint for divorce on Wednesday. Goodwin's attorney declined to comment.

Us Weekly was the first to report the news of the divorce.

Authorities arrested Victoria Goodwin, 32, on March 6 on suspicion of two felony charges: solicitation to commit murder and conspiring to commit murder, according to county court records. She has been held on $100,000 bail at the Clark County Detention Center. Records show the Goodwins live in Las Vegas.

According to a criminal complaint against Victoria Goodwin, filed March 8 and obtained by USA TODAY Friday, the Clark County District Attorney's Office says she conspired with a man via cell phone to have her husband "killed by a third party by providing the location of the victim and providing funds to pay for the murder."

Victoria and Aaron Goodwin were married in August 2022. Victoria Goodwin was arrested last week on suspicion of soliciting her husband's murder.

Her next hearing is set for March 25.

Investigators uncovered the alleged plot through Victoria Goodwin's communications with an inmate in Florida in October, NBC News, CNN and E! News reported. According to the news organizations, police said the two were conspiring to hire a third party to murder Aaron Goodwin.

The police report for Victoria Goodwin's arrest reportedly contains messages between her and the inmate, according to the outlets. They also report that, per police, in one of the communications she asks whether she's "a bad person" because she “chose to end" her husband's "existence." She also reportedly shared information about her husband's whereabouts at one point, according to police.

Victoria Goodwin reportedly denied wanting her husband to be killed but said they "were going through problems in their marriage," CNN and NBC News reported, citing police.

USA TODAY has reached out to Victoria Goodwin's listed attorney, the Clark County District Attorney's Office and the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department for additional information.

Where has 'Ghost Adventures' investigated in Nevada?

Aaron Goodwin is a camera operator and star of the Discovery+ paranormal and reality TV series led by paranormal investigator Zak Bagans. The show has been on air since 2008 and has featured numerous locations across the state, including:

  • Goldfield Hotel, Goldfield
  • Old Washoe Club & Chollar Mine, Virginia City
  • Mizpah Hotel, Tonopah
  • Bonnie Springs Ranch, Blue Diamond
  • Pioneer Saloon, Goodsprings
  • Nevada State Prison, Carson City
  • La Palazza Mansion, Las Vegas
  • Eureka Mining Town, Eureka
  • Mustang Ranch, Sparks
